Star Wars: EpisodeĀ IX:
Star Wars: Episode IX is now set for release onĀ December 20, 2019. Directed byĀ the returning J.J AbramsĀ (Star Wars: The Force Awakens), the film will close out the third Star Wars trilogy that began with the 2015 juggernaut, The Force Awakens.

Indiana Jones:
The exciting new fifth chapter of the Indiana Jones series is now confirmed for a July 10, 2020 release. Both Steven Spielberg, director of every instalment of the Indiana Jones franchise, and legendary star Harrison Ford will return to reprise his famous role.
